What property owners run into before they hire
Start with the issues, tradeoffs, and service expectations that usually shape the decision.
Water damage restoration in Edgewood generally starts with assessing the extent of the problem, often using tools like thermal imaging and moisture meters to spot hidden water in walls, floors, and insulation. From there, high-powered pumps and extractors remove standing water swiftly, followed by air movers and dehumidifiers to dry everything out thoroughlyβcrucial in our sticky Texas humidity.
Expect containment measures to limit spread, along with antimicrobial treatments where needed to curb mold growth. Belongings get careful handling, sometimes with packing and protection to minimize losses. Documentation like photos, drying logs, and notes supports insurance processes, helping streamline claims.
Regional factors play a big role: clay-heavy soils slow drainage, so structural drying takes vigilance. Storms bring floodwater that might need special cleanup, and older homes' pier-and-beam setups can hide pockets of moisture. The goal is stabilization to prevent secondary damage, with monitoring to ensure dryness before rebuilds.
Homeowners here appreciate the focus on full drying to avoid callbacks, especially since our weather doesn't cooperate. This comprehensive approach fits the local landscape, from cozy family homes to small commercial spots.
What makes Edgewood different
Regional conditions, service expectations, and local patterns can all influence what matters most.
Edgewood sits in Van Zandt County with a mix of established older homes from the mid-20th century and newer developments on larger lots typical of East Texas suburbs. The flat terrain and proximity to lakes contribute to occasional flooding from heavy spring rains or thunderstorms. Humid subtropical weather means quick drying is key to avoid mold, and many properties feature slab foundations or pier-and-beam setups that influence water intrusion patterns.
Development is low-density, with rural edges blending into farmland, so access can vary for larger equipment.
Homeowners commonly encounter burst pipes from winter cold snaps, roof leaks after intense storms, sump pump overloads in low spots, and appliance failures like water heaters. In older homes, aging plumbing exacerbates leaks, while newer builds might deal with poor grading leading to foundation moisture. Storm-related flooding affects outskirts more, and high humidity prolongs drying times.
